    PDS smart card switch likely in August

    Work on issue of smart cards to Chennai ration card holders is likely to start from August and not from July as envisioned earlier, according to civil supplies department officials.

    Details of nearly 60 lakh families have been procured from Aadhaar cards submitted by ration card holders in 13 districts including Tiruchy, Perambalur, Ariyalur, Theni, Dindigul, Virudunagar and Thoothukudi where the work on collection of details is now under way, officials said. “Work in the remaining 17 districts will be undertaken on completion of work in the 13 districts,” officials said, adding issue of smart card would start by November for the entire state. They would be issued to consumers through their local FPS (fair price shops).  

    “Smart card work has been started on a trial basis in some shops in Chennai, where consumers have been asked to come to the shop with their Aadhaar card to duplicate the information in the Aadhaar card into the smart card,” officials added.  It is a huge exercise as there are over 1.98 crore ration card holders in the state. 

    Ration rice and pulses are issued through 33,222 FPS including 25,049 full time and 8,173 part-time shops. There are 3,54,152 holders in North Chennai, while there are 1,77, 122 ration cards holders in South Chennai. 

    With validity of current ration cards ending in December this year, officials are confident that smart card work for the entire state would be completed on time and cards issued to consumers to enable them to draw their rations through them. Once issued, the smart cards—similar to an ATM card—  will enable a consumer to know what, when and how much ration he/she has drawn and the balance of all commodities in the smart-shop. 

    “This is expected to weed out illegal sales by FPS salesmen and also end smuggling of PDS rice to neighbouring states,” officials said.   “A Chennai based firm is handling the logistics for this enterprise”, officials added.
